Port Blair, Nov. 28: Shri Suneel Anchipaka, Deputy Commissioner (SA) along with SDM (SA) inspected various developmental activities being carried out at Sippighat, Meethakhari, Namunaghar, Shaitankhadi to Wimberlygunj. Officials from Revenue, RD and other line departments also accompanied.

During the inspection the DC(SA) had a brief meeting with ex- Pradhans, local Representatives and residents and gave a patient hearing to their grievances related to Road Condition, Drinking water, electricity, playground development at Ograbraj Middle School, Street lights and various other issues.

Directions were given to the officials of the line departments by DC (SA) for the redressal of the grievances at the earliest in a time bound manner.  The DC (SA) along with the team also inspected the Health & Wellness centre at Wimberlygunj. During the visit the medical staff present there reported about the lack of sufficient sanitary staff and medical equipment. DC (SA) assured to take up matter with concerned authorities for resolving the said issues.

The local residents lauded the efforts of DC (SA) for the works undertaken under the RURBAN mission such as market place, guest house at shore point, Shade at Bus stands, community hall and Road under PMGSY-I.

The DC (SA) reiterated that the District Administration is committed to the development of infrastructure and its maintenance in South Andaman and also sought the cooperation of the local populace in its efforts. The DC (SA) asked the Revenue & RD field staffs to follow up on all the matters raised by the public. He further asked the public to feel free to reach out to his office for their genuine grievances.
